|
Share-based compensation - Additional Information (Details)
|12 Months Ended
|
Dec. 31, 2021
USD ($)
shares
|
Dec. 31, 2020
USD ($)
shares
|
Dec. 31, 2019
USD ($)
shares
|
Dec. 31, 2017
shares
|Disclosure Of Share Based Payments [Line Items]
|Weighted-average contractual life for stock options outstanding
|2 years 8 months 12 days
|2 years 10 months 24 days
|2 years 10 months 24 days
|Weighted-average share price at exercise for options exercised (in dollars per share) | $
|$ 280.08
|$ 198.10
|$ 141.82
|Weighted average fair value at measurement date, share options granted (in dollars per share) | $
|$ 78.65
|$ 36.82
|$ 34.63
|Increase decrease in expected life
|one year
|Employee Stock Option Plans | 2020 Plans
|Disclosure Of Share Based Payments [Line Items]
|Percentage of fair value of ordinary shares
|150.00%
|Options granted period
|5 years
|Employee Stock Option Plans | 2020 Plans | Minimum | Vesting Tranche After First Vesting Period
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|3 months
|Employee Stock Option Plans | 2020 Plans | Maximum | Vesting Tranche After First Vesting Period
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|8 months
|Restricted stock units
|Disclosure Of Share Based Payments [Line Items]
|Number of shares granted (in shares)
|793,337
|1,127,149
|715,224
|Restricted stock units | 2020 Plans
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|4 years
|Restricted stock units | 2020 Plans | Minimum | Vesting Tranche After First Vesting Period
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|3 months
|Restricted stock units | 2020 Plans | Maximum | Vesting Tranche After First Vesting Period
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|8 months
|Restricted stock awards
|Disclosure Of Share Based Payments [Line Items]
|Number of shares granted (in shares)
|0
|0
|0
|Restricted stock awards | 2017 Acquiree
|Disclosure Of Share Based Payments [Line Items]
|Number of shares issued (in shares)
|61,880
|Restricted stock awards | Bottom of Range | 2017 Acquiree
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|2 years
|Restricted stock awards | Top of Range | 2017 Acquiree
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|3 years
|Other contingently issuable shares
|Disclosure Of Share Based Payments [Line Items]
|Number of shares granted (in shares)
|22,988
|34,450
|162,320
|Other contingently issuable shares | Anchor
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|4 years
|Number of shares granted (in shares)
|162,320
|Grant date fair value of each equity instrument (in dollars per share) | $
|$ 145.21
|Other contingently issuable shares | The Ringer
|Disclosure Of Share Based Payments [Line Items]
|Vesting period
|5 years
|Number of shares granted (in shares)
|34,450
|Grant date fair value of each equity instrument (in dollars per share) | $
|$ 145.14
|X
- Definition
+ References
Disclosure of share based payments.
+ Details
No definition available.
|X
- Definition
+ References
Grant date fair value of each equity instrument.
+ Details
No definition available.
|X
- Definition
+ References
Increase decrease in expected life.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ares issued under share based compensation.
+ Details
No definition available.
|X
- Definition
+ References
Percentage of fair value of ordinary shares.
+ Details
No definition available.
|X
- Definition
+ References
Share based paymens award, options term.
+ Details
No definition available.
|X
- Definition
+ References
Vesting period.
+ Details
No definition available.
|X
- Definition
+ References
Weighted-average contractual life for share options outstanding.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average share price at the time of exercise of options exercised during the period.
+ Details
No definition available.
|X
- Definition
+ References
The number of other equity instruments (ie other than share options) granted in a share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The weighted average fair value of share options granted during the period at the measurement date. [Refer: Weighted average [member]]
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details